What methods of resistance do rowing machine manufactures use Explain each method?

Air - vanes on a flywheel are slowed by air resistance Water - vanes on a flywheel are slowed by water resistance Magnetic - flywheel on the rowing machine is slowed by force encountered from magnetism Friction - a wheel on the rowing machine is slowed from contact with a pad Hydraulic - resistance is provided by forcing oil through an orifice in a hydraulic cylinder Most 'real' rowing machines use air, some use water, all others are toys or worse (as in the case of hydraulic cylinders)

What is air resistance and what are the two factors that air resistance depends on?

Air resistance is the force that opposes the motion of an object through the air. It depends on the speed of the object and its surface area exposed to the air.

What is air resistance affected by?

Air resistance is affected by the speed of the object moving through the air, the cross-sectional area of the object, the density of the air, and the shape of the object. Objects with larger surface areas and higher speeds experience greater air resistance.
